Position SummaryHenderson Building Solutions is seeking Site Superintendents in Boardman, Oregon across multiple experience levels to support our growing Mission Critical work. This role is responsible for leading the day-to-day field execution of construction projects, including site logistics, safety compliance, scheduling, labor coordination, and quality control. We are hiring across multiple levels (Site Superintendent I-III). Candidates will be aligned to the appropriate level based on experience, skills, and leadership capability.
Scope and complexity of responsibilities will vary accordingly.
- Assist in or lead development of project schedules in coordination with subcontractors, suppliers, and internal teams
- Provide input on schedule of values and update project completion percentages for billing purposes
- Plan and manage site logistics to ensure efficient workflow and minimal disruption to client operations
- Direct day-to-day site operations including coordination of labor, materials, and equipment
- Review construction methods and adjust execution strategies to meet project goals and timelines
- Track and communicate project progress, milestones, and schedule impacts
- Maintain accurate project documentation including schedules, reports, and field updates
- Ensure labor continuity and proactively address potential disruptions to the project schedule
- Coordinate subcontractors and field teams to maintain productivity and alignment with project timelines
- Communicate effectively with clients and stakeholders to minimize impact to ongoing operations
- Support resolution of labor challenges, including union and non-union considerations as applicable
- Implement and maintain the organization's quality control plan for each project
- Monitor field execution to ensure compliance with company standards and client expectations
- Identify quality concerns and communicate with leadership to develop and implement corrective action plans
- Ensure corrective actions are executed without unnecessary disruption to the project schedule
